First showroom in Mumbai, second soon in Delhi!
According to reports, 4,000 square feet in BKC Tesla for this showroom of Fare of about 35 lakh rupees every month Will have to give. This deal for five years Has been done.
After this Tesla Delhi’s Aerosity Complex I am planning to open my second showroom.

Tesla’s launching challenges in India
Tesla to sell his cars in India Many business hurdles Is facing
- In India Import tax up to 110% It seems, which is very much for companies like Tesla.
- America has called this tax “business obstruction” And demanded to reduce it.
- Alan Musk many times Appeal to reduce this tax Have done
